Ver Mensaje Individual
  #4 (permalink)  
Antiguo 16/07/2011, 02:18
sidneyendis
Invitado
 
Mensajes: n/a
Puntos:
Respuesta: No funciona UNLINK ni tampoco UPDATE

Estoy contentísimo! también me he dado del error que cometí en borrar.php y ya me funciona a la perfección.

El error era que eliminaba antes el registro que la imagen y por lo tanto el nombre de la imagen a eliminar no lo encontraba, os pongo el código para que lo comprendais mejor:

Borrar.php (Antigüo):

Código PHP:
<?php 
    
include ("conexion.php"); 
     
//aquí empezaba a eliminar el registro
    
$codigo=$_POST['codigo'];  
    
mysql_query ("delete from propiedades where referencia =('$codigo')",$conexion
?> 
<?php 
//y aquí empezaba a eliminar la imagen
if(unlink ("fotos/logo.jpg")) 

    echo 
"Propiedad eliminada"
    } 
else 
    echo 
"Error al eliminar propiedad"
?> 
<?php 
    mysql_close
($conexion); 
?>
El código actual de borrar.php:

Código PHP:
<?php
    
include ("conexion.php");
    
    
$codigo=$_POST['codigo']; 
         
// En este código empiezo eliminando primero la imagen
    
$resp mysql_query("select * from propiedades where referencia =('$codigo')") ;
    
$datos mysql_fetch_array($resp) ;
    
$archivo "fotos/" $datos['foto'];
    if(
unlink ($archivo))
    {
    echo 
"Propiedad eliminada";
    }
    else
    echo 
"Error al eliminar propiedad";
    
// Y después el registro
    
mysql_query ("delete from propiedades where referencia =('$codigo')",$conexion)
?>
<?php
    mysql_close
($conexion);
?>
Que sencillo parece cuando ya visualizas en que te equivocas.... jajaja

Bueno un saludo muy grande!!